  1. A pneumonia that was not incubating at the time of admission is one that develops a minimum of how many hours after admission?
a. 12 hours
b. 24 hours
c. 48 hours
d. 72 hours

 

 

ANS:   C

Pneumonias that develop 48 hours after a patient is admitted or placed on a mechanical ventilator are hospital-acquired pneumonias.

  1. The type of organism that most often causes ventilator-acquired pneumonia is which of the following?
a. Fungi
b. Bacteria
c. Viruses
d. Protozoa

 

 

ANS:   B

Ventilator-associated pneumonia (VAP) is most often caused by bacterial infections, but it can be caused by fungal infections or associated with viral epidemics.

  1. A patient was intubated in the emergency department just after arrival at the hospital from home. This patient develops VAP 36 hours after intubation. What type of pneumonia is this considered?
a. Early-onset VAP
b. Late-onset VAP
c. Health care–associated pneumonia
d. Non–hospital-acquired pneumonia

 

 

ANS:   D

The development of pneumonia within 48 hours of admission and intubation is a result of an infection that was incubating at the time of admission.

  1. The mortality rate for VAP associated with prolonged hospital stays is which of the following?
a. 5% to 25%
b. 15% to 40%
c. 25% to 50%
d. 45% to 75%

 

 

ANS:   C

The mortality rate for ventilator-associated pneumonia is 25% to 50%.

  1. Sixty percent of all VAP infections are caused by which of the following?
a. Aerobic gram-negative bacilli
b. Anaerobic gram-negative bacilli
c. Aerobic gram-negative rods
d. Anaerobic gram-positive cocci

 

 

ANS:   A

Aerobic gram-negative bacilli have accounted for nearly 60% of all VAP infections. The most common of these are Pseudomonas aeruginosa, Klebsiella pneumoniae, Escherichia coli, and Acinetobacter sp.
